I thought the "leaning more heavily into action" aspect was interesting - with 5 being even more action oriented than 4, and then 6 being mostly a straight up action/3rd person shooter game (and getting heavy criticism for it). But it was clearly the direction they wanted to take with series at one point.

Ironically of course - The DMC games are far better action games than Resi 5 or 6 .

I do wonder where they'll go next with the remakes or if 4 is going to be the last... 5 would be a difficult one to remake and 6, I just don't know if there's any desire for one. I think a Resi 6 remake would need to just be a whole new game but still cover the same basic story elements. A lot of it is kind of redundant in terms of the over-arching story.
